You've already forked godot
mirror of
https://github.com/godotengine/godot.git
synced 2025-11-12 13:20:55 +00:00
Replace NULL with nullptr
This commit is contained in:
@@ -58,9 +58,9 @@ void GDMonoMethod::_update_signature(MonoMethodSignature *p_method_sig) {
|
||||
}
|
||||
}
|
||||
|
||||
void *iter = NULL;
|
||||
void *iter = nullptr;
|
||||
MonoType *param_raw_type;
|
||||
while ((param_raw_type = mono_signature_get_params(p_method_sig, &iter)) != NULL) {
|
||||
while ((param_raw_type = mono_signature_get_params(p_method_sig, &iter)) != nullptr) {
|
||||
ManagedType param_type;
|
||||
|
||||
param_type.type_encoding = mono_type_get_type(param_raw_type);
|
||||
@@ -81,11 +81,11 @@ GDMonoClass *GDMonoMethod::get_enclosing_class() const {
|
||||
}
|
||||
|
||||
bool GDMonoMethod::is_static() {
|
||||
return mono_method_get_flags(mono_method, NULL) & MONO_METHOD_ATTR_STATIC;
|
||||
return mono_method_get_flags(mono_method, nullptr) & MONO_METHOD_ATTR_STATIC;
|
||||
}
|
||||
|
||||
IMonoClassMember::Visibility GDMonoMethod::get_visibility() {
|
||||
switch (mono_method_get_flags(mono_method, NULL) & MONO_METHOD_ATTR_ACCESS_MASK) {
|
||||
switch (mono_method_get_flags(mono_method, nullptr) & MONO_METHOD_ATTR_ACCESS_MASK) {
|
||||
case MONO_METHOD_ATTR_PRIVATE:
|
||||
return IMonoClassMember::PRIVATE;
|
||||
case MONO_METHOD_ATTR_FAM_AND_ASSEM:
|
||||
@@ -102,7 +102,7 @@ IMonoClassMember::Visibility GDMonoMethod::get_visibility() {
|
||||
}
|
||||
|
||||
MonoObject *GDMonoMethod::invoke(MonoObject *p_object, const Variant **p_params, MonoException **r_exc) const {
|
||||
MonoException *exc = NULL;
|
||||
MonoException *exc = nullptr;
|
||||
MonoObject *ret;
|
||||
|
||||
if (params_count > 0) {
|
||||
@@ -115,11 +115,11 @@ MonoObject *GDMonoMethod::invoke(MonoObject *p_object, const Variant **p_params,
|
||||
|
||||
ret = GDMonoUtils::runtime_invoke_array(mono_method, p_object, params, &exc);
|
||||
} else {
|
||||
ret = GDMonoUtils::runtime_invoke(mono_method, p_object, NULL, &exc);
|
||||
ret = GDMonoUtils::runtime_invoke(mono_method, p_object, nullptr, &exc);
|
||||
}
|
||||
|
||||
if (exc) {
|
||||
ret = NULL;
|
||||
ret = nullptr;
|
||||
if (r_exc) {
|
||||
*r_exc = exc;
|
||||
} else {
|
||||
@@ -131,16 +131,16 @@ MonoObject *GDMonoMethod::invoke(MonoObject *p_object, const Variant **p_params,
|
||||
}
|
||||
|
||||
MonoObject *GDMonoMethod::invoke(MonoObject *p_object, MonoException **r_exc) const {
|
||||
ERR_FAIL_COND_V(get_parameters_count() > 0, NULL);
|
||||
return invoke_raw(p_object, NULL, r_exc);
|
||||
ERR_FAIL_COND_V(get_parameters_count() > 0, nullptr);
|
||||
return invoke_raw(p_object, nullptr, r_exc);
|
||||
}
|
||||
|
||||
MonoObject *GDMonoMethod::invoke_raw(MonoObject *p_object, void **p_params, MonoException **r_exc) const {
|
||||
MonoException *exc = NULL;
|
||||
MonoException *exc = nullptr;
|
||||
MonoObject *ret = GDMonoUtils::runtime_invoke(mono_method, p_object, p_params, &exc);
|
||||
|
||||
if (exc) {
|
||||
ret = NULL;
|
||||
ret = nullptr;
|
||||
if (r_exc) {
|
||||
*r_exc = exc;
|
||||
} else {
|
||||
@@ -164,19 +164,19 @@ bool GDMonoMethod::has_attribute(GDMonoClass *p_attr_class) {
|
||||
}
|
||||
|
||||
MonoObject *GDMonoMethod::get_attribute(GDMonoClass *p_attr_class) {
|
||||
ERR_FAIL_NULL_V(p_attr_class, NULL);
|
||||
ERR_FAIL_NULL_V(p_attr_class, nullptr);
|
||||
|
||||
if (!attrs_fetched)
|
||||
fetch_attributes();
|
||||
|
||||
if (!attributes)
|
||||
return NULL;
|
||||
return nullptr;
|
||||
|
||||
return mono_custom_attrs_get_attr(attributes, p_attr_class->get_mono_ptr());
|
||||
}
|
||||
|
||||
void GDMonoMethod::fetch_attributes() {
|
||||
ERR_FAIL_COND(attributes != NULL);
|
||||
ERR_FAIL_COND(attributes != nullptr);
|
||||
attributes = mono_custom_attrs_from_method(mono_method);
|
||||
attrs_fetched = true;
|
||||
}
|
||||
@@ -281,7 +281,7 @@ GDMonoMethod::GDMonoMethod(StringName p_name, MonoMethod *p_method) {
|
||||
method_info_fetched = false;
|
||||
|
||||
attrs_fetched = false;
|
||||
attributes = NULL;
|
||||
attributes = nullptr;
|
||||
|
||||
_update_signature();
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user